Embodiment 1

[0038] (1) Soil preparation, apply organic manure to adjust the soil, apply 30 tons of organic manure per hectare, so that the soil contains 8g / kg-10g / kg of organic matter.

[0039] Apply nitrogen fertilizer containing 90kg of nitrogen per hectare, so that the total nitrogen content of the soil reaches 0.45g / kg-0.85g / kg, and the soil alkaline nitrogen content reaches 45mg / kg-51.5mg / kg.

[0040] Apply phosphorus fertilizer containing 67kg of phosphorus pentoxide per hectare to make the soil available phosphorus content reach 10mg / kg-17.5mg / kg.

[0041] Apply potassium fertilizer containing 60-90kg of potassium oxide per hectare to make the soil available potassium content reach 90mg / kg.

[0042] (2) Seed treatment, first screen out seeds of different sizes through a screening machine, and then manually select to remove broken, dirty, diseased, black and poorly matured seeds, and keep seeds of the same size and color;

Abstract

The invention provides a method for cultivating chickpeas. The method comprises the following steps: applying organic manure to adjust soil to enable the soil contains 8-12 g/kg of organic matter; selecting seeds, airing the seeds in the sun, stirring the seeds with a carbendazim colloidal suspension agent and difenoconazole, and finally carrying out drying for later use; carrying out seeding, wherein the seeding amount is 43.3-53.4 kg/hm<2>, the plant spacing is 15-20 cm, and the seedling survival number is 150-166 thousand plants/hm<2>; carrying out intertillage after germination, carrying out weeding and hilling, carrying out topdressing at an early flowering stage, and carrying out irrigation; and carrying out harvesting when leaves of plants fall, chickpea pods turn yellow and chickpeas are hardened. When chickpeas are planted by the method provided by the invention, the yield of the chickpeas cultivated in high-altitude cold drought regions with altitudes of 1100-2000 m at northern latitude of 36.9-39.5 degrees is increased, the growth period can be shortened, the chickpeas are larger, and plant morbidity can be reduced.

Background technique [0002] Chickpea, a Papilionaceae herb, is also known as Taoer bean, chickpea, chickpea, etc. It is one of the important vegetables in India and Pakistan. It is also very common to eat chickpea in Europe, and it is also a commonly used medicinal material in Uighur medicine. . It is called this name because of its peculiar face shape, which is as sharp as an eagle's beak. my country introduced it from the former Soviet Union in the 1950s, and it has been widely planted in Qinghai, Xinjiang, Gansu, Yunnan and other places. The starch of chickpeas has a chestnut aroma. Soymilk powder made from chickpea flour and milk powder is easy to absorb and digest, and is a nutritious food for infants and the elderly.
